Have you ever wanted to connect with your professors outside the classroom? Are you interested in having meaningful conversations about their career paths, life experiences, and your personal goals? We’re here to help.
Many students, especially those in their first year, want to connect with their professors but worry they might be too busy to meet outside of class or office hours. Professors can provide invaluable insights into career opportunities in your field of study and share meaningful perspectives from their own life experiences.
“Coffee with a Prof” is your chance to invite your professor for a free cup of coffee in an informal setting to get to know each other and share your experiences.
How It Works
1. Choose Your Professor
Select a participating professor and reach out to them directly to set up a coffee meeting. Use the email template below if you’d like some help drafting your invitation. Work together to find a time that works for both of you.
Free Coffee Vouchers: Both you and your professor will receive a free coffee voucher from General Brock.

2. Complete Participation form
Once you’ve settled on a time with your professor, complete the Student Participation Form.
3. Get Your Coffee Voucher
After submitting the form, wait for your confirmation email from Student Life. It will include details on when you can pick up your voucher.
4. Meet and Enjoy Your Coffee!
Head to General Brock and enjoy your free coffee with your professor. Both you and your professor must be present, with your physical voucher to get the coffee.
Important Notes and Guidelines
The Coffee with a Prof program is open to first-year students and runs until March 31, 2025.
This program is not meant for academic advising and is not an extension of your professor’s office hours, so please refrain from discussing academic support questions during your meeting.
